Dethroned Olofa sues for peace
Oba Gbadamosi made the call shortly after the Court of Appeal yesterday nullified his ascension to the throne.
The Oba said no one should lose any sleep over the development as he has directed his lawyers to lodge an appealof the judgment with the
Supreme Court, stressing that having first won at the court of first instance, he remained optimistic of justice at the apex court.
While addressing a mammoth crowd of sympathizers at the palace,
Oba Gbadamosi urged the people to go and prepare for the Ramadan fast
and be happy in their deeds, as there wass no cause for alarm.
People have been going about normal businesses in the town in spite of the judgment that removed the Olofa and there was no security threat or breach of peace.
